No it isn't.

TCPMP is a great player. I used it for years. I continue to use it even after I bought Coreplayer two years ago, because the first release of Coreplayer had some serious problems.

Those have all been fixed, and Coreplayer now is superior to TCPMP in a variety of ways: Performance, features, UI responsiveness, and others.

Whether or not it's worth $30 is up to each individual of course. I think it easily is.
